Here’s the Trailer for Lynne Koplitz’s Netflix Standup Special ‘Hormonal Beast’

Comedy Central Presents, Last Comic Standing, and Comedy Knockout alum Lynne Koplitz makes her Netflix standup special debut later this month, and today the streaming network released the trailer. Titled Hormonal Beast, the special was taped in New York City and debuts on Netflix Tuesday, August 22nd. Here’s the logline: Unabashed, menopausal New Yorker and […]

Shane Torres’s Debut Standup Album ‘Established 1981’ Is Out Next Month

New York-based comedian Shane Torres is making his standup album debut next month. Comedy Central Records will release the album, titled Established 1981, on Friday, September 8th, and it will also be available for free on Laughly for 24 hours prior to release. ‘HarmonQuest,’ ‘MBMBaM,’ ‘Hidden America,’ and ‘Cyanide & Happiness’ Find a New Home at VRV

The Seeso exodus has officially begun. Today, the streaming platform VRV announced that it’s added four Seeso comedies to its new VRV Select service, including Hidden America with Jonah Ray, The Cyanide & Happiness Show, My Brother, My Brother and Me, and Dan Harmon’s HarmonQuest, which will debut its second season on Friday, September 15th.
